Xbox 360 Ad Concepts From Gamers

Jump In adMost probably inspired by the good reception of the Jump In ad (check it out here), which also won Best of Show in this year’s ADDY Awards, Microsoft asked gamers to pitch in their own ideas for an Xbox 360 advertisement. Although this was done mainly for fun and the ideas will most unfortunately not be realized, it was still fun browsing through the bright ides gamers had to project Microsoft’s next-gen console. Here are some of my faves:

  • KjellShocked (Shirley , NY)

Although undoubtedly a ripoff of Visa’s popular ‘Priceless’ ads, KjellShocked’s idea still made me laugh. Priceless indeed:

Xbox 360 PremiumÂ…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â… $399.00
High-speed Internet connectionÂ…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â… $29.99
Pwning your boss on Xbox LiveÂ…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Â…Priceless

  • Izod the Great (Somers, CT)

Imagine two teenage guys hanging out at a local pond, they seem very bored and they have nothing to do. One of them hears a noise and walks up to the edge of the pond and looks out at the water. He hears the noise again and decides to throw a pebble into the water. When he throws the pebble into the water, the ripples form the green circles of the Xbox 360 logo. He throws more rocks and his friend joins him, and eventually the whole pond is covered in Xbox 360 ripples and it dramatically says ‘Jump In’. Also, if that’s not enough, I had also thought it would work if when they throw the rocks, many other gamers come out of the trees surrounding the pond and they begin to throw rocks as well. Or, when the two boys throw pebbles, they see the faces of gamers in the pond with headsets on.

  • Chilled Chaos (New Hyde Park, New York)

Camera slowly zooms in on a gorgeous single family home in a quaint, quiet neighborhood as the stars twinkle over a beautifully moon-lit summer sky. The camera captures a young man, around age 30, stepping out on to his front porch with a cellular phone at his ear. As the camera zooms in close to him, you hear the happy chirping of crickets along with the young man’s telephone conversation.

Young Man: (Excitedly) Well, Ma, I finally did it. I purchased my very first home!
Mom: Son, I’m so proud of you! It’s like I’ve always said, all of that hard work and studying would one day pay off.
Young Man: You were right, Ma. What more could I ask for? I can’t wait to have everyone over to check the place out.
Mom: Oh Joey, I can’t wait either. Tell me what you need. I need to get you a nice house warming gift!
Young Man : Don’t worry about it, Ma, I’ve got everything I need. See ya real soon. Love ya!
Mom: Take care son. I love you too!

Camera cuts to a close up of the young man smiling as he hangs up the phone, stretches and takes a long look at the warm night sky and enters his home. He closes the door as the camera pans a completely empty room, void of furniture, pictures or anything else. The camera zooms in on a 42″ plasma TV hanging on the wall, displaying Kameo riding on a horse. The camera pans back to Joey as he sits down on the floor, reaching for his Xbox 360 controller with a huge grin on his face. Picture fades out displaying Xbox 360 Logo and, “Jump In!”
